Giovanni Bertati (10 July 1735 – 1815) was an Italian librettist. http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Giovanni_Bertati Bertati was born in Martellago, Italy. In 1763, he wrote his first libretto, La morte di Dimone ("The Death of Dimone"), set to music by Antonio Tozzi. Two years later, L'isola della fortuna ("The Island of Fortune"), based on Bertati's libretto and Andrea Luchesi's music, was performed in Vienna.
